Hamilton (NYSE: HG) underwrites specialty insurance and reinsurance risks on a global basis through its wholly owned subsidiaries. Its three underwriting platforms: Hamilton Global Specialty Hamilton Select and Hamilton Re each with dedicated and experienced leadership provide access to diversified and profitable business around the world.


Headquartered in Bermuda Hamilton has over 550 employees with key underwriting operations in London Bermuda the US and Dublin. Underwriting Operations Assistant Hamilton Select

Based in Richmond Virginia and reporting to the Underwriting Operations Team Lead Hamilton Select the successful candidate will join Hamiltons growingBusiness/Services Operations in the US.

This role will help supportHamiltons growing E&S segment in the US. Coverages and lines of business will include General Liability Products Liability Allied Medical Management Liability Environmental/Pollution with other new products planned in the future.

Hamilton Select is our US excess and surplus lines insurer based in Richmond Virginia underwriting hardtoplace accounts in the small and middlemarket space through an appointed wholesale broker network.

What you will do

  • Liaise with our underwriting teams to enter business into our underwriting system by following agreed guidelines including but not limited to entering submissions renewals premium & nonbearing premium endorsement transactions
  • Responsible for generating and issuing accurate policy documentation based on Underwriting Procedures guidelines and ordering inspections and premium audits where applicable
  • Ensure that all active brokers are vetted through our compliance system and updated in our underwriting system in accordance with their business agreement with Hamilton
  • Set up and maintain comprehensive electronic policy files
  • Assist with the processing of cancellation notices including but not limited to nonrenewals nonpay etc
  • Manage the renewal letter solicitation process for applicable products to assure renewal information for underwriters is received before renewal dates
  • Monitor all relevant reports to ensure that our underwriting activity data is accurate for our US E&Sbased underwriters
  • Liaise with underwriting and compliance to maintain and update the forms library for each product
  • Provide support to the U.S. Operations Manager and other stakeholders as required
  • Act in accordance with all applicable supervisory bodies principals rules and regulations
